Question
A force is applied to a door at an angle of 56.8° and 0.34 m from the hinge.
a) What force produces a torque with a magnitude of 2.18 N·m?
b) How large is the maximum torque this force can exert?
a) What force produces a torque with a magnitude of 2.18 N·m?
b) How large is the maximum torque this force can exert?
Answers
Fdsin theda=T
(sin 56.8*)(.34)F=2.18
F=7.66
